Abstract
The present invention relates to novel cholesteric layered materials having the layer sequence A /B/A , where A and A are identical or different and each comprise at least one cholesteric layer, and B is at least one interlayer separating the layers A and A from one another, wherein layer B is an adhesive layer; cholesteric multilayered pigments which can be produced therefrom; a process for their production, and their use.
